WebThe easiest way to draw slots in Eagle without unexpected issues is to do the following: Add 2 Vias, representing the start and end of the slot. Set the Drill property set to the desired slot width. On the Milling layer, draw a line between the center of each via. Set the Width of this line equal to the slot width. WebNov 18, 2010 · If there are actual pads that aren't connected to your traces - Strip your wire extra long, run it through the hole in the board, solder to the pad, then bend the extra wire over to the trace and solder to the trace. If no pad - drill a hole close to your trace, strip the wire extra long, bend the strip over to the trace and solder to the trace.
